Measuring AI Agency: Defining and Quantifying Autonomy

Assessing autonomy in artificial intelligence (AI) presents a complex challenge. Traditionally, we conceptualize agency as the capacity to act independently and make unconstrained decisions. However, applying this concept to AI systems, which operate based on algorithms and vast datasets, requires a nuanced understanding. Quantifying AI agency involves examining various attributes, such as the system's ability to evolve its behavior in response to environmental inputs, the extent to which it can create novel outputs, and its capacity for goal-directed action.

  • One approach to measuring AI agency is through benchmarking tasks that simulate real-world scenarios requiring decision-making under uncertainty.
  • Additionally, analyzing the structure of AI algorithms can shed light on their potential for autonomy.
  • Ultimately, a comprehensive framework for measuring AI agency should consider both numerical and experiential aspects.

Nurturing Responsible AI: Fostering Agency with Human Values

The rapid advancement of artificial intelligence (AI) presents both immense opportunities and complex challenges. To harness the transformative power of AI while mitigating potential risks, it is crucial to cultivate responsible AI systems that align with human values. This involves not only technical safeguards but also a fundamental shift in our understanding of agency and its interplay with AI. Ultimately, we must strive to design AI systems that empower human agency, respecting individual autonomy and promoting societal well-being. A key aspect of this endeavor is fostering transparency and explainability in AI decision-making processes. By making AI's reasoning more understandable to humans, we can build trust and ensure that AI systems are used ethically and responsibly. Moreover, it is essential to integrate human values into the very fabric of AI development. This requires ongoing dialogue between AI researchers, ethicists, policymakers, and the general public to establish shared principles and guidelines for responsible AI deployment.
